Do Amazon gift cards expire if not redeemed?
Amazon Gift Cards DO NOT expire even if they are not used. You can redeem your Amazon gift card at any time. Once you’ve activated your gift card and added it to your account balance, you can use it to purchase products through the Amazon website or app.

Although Amazon gift cards cannot expire, it is best to activate the gift card as soon as possible after receiving it to avoid loss or misplacement of the card.

When you redeem a gift card, you don’t have to use it immediately. Instead, the money stays on your gift card balance and you can always use it on your next purchase.

If you don’t use it right away, the funds will stay safe and you won’t lose any value.

Amazon is clear on this – “The portion of your Amazon.com balance made up of gift cards issued after October 1, 2005 will not expire and may be applied to your Amazon.com account and applied to eligible purchases despite any stated expiration date.

. Expiration dates also do not apply to the portion of your Amazon.com balance made up of gift cards issued before October 1, 2005 in CA, CT, LA, ME, MD, MA, MT, NH, ND, OK, RI , VT, WA or in any other jurisdiction only to the extent prohibited or limited by law. All other gift cards issued before October 1, 2005 and the portion of your Amazon.com balance made up of those gift cards will expire in accordance with their stated terms.”

Can you redeem Amazon gift cards?
The problem is that Amazon gift cards are not used to cash out. They are not cash based cards. They are paid directly to Amazon and therefore can only be exchanged for Amazon products. They are non-transferable to other sellers and non-refundable.

The only way to get cash in exchange for an Amazon gift card is to offer it to an individual buyer. Still, even if you use a website like eBay or Amazon, there will be fees for the service that can be deducted from the amount you can earn.

What are Amazon Gift Cards?
Amazon Gift Cards are prepaid cards that you can use to shop on Amazon. These cards are available in physical and digital form and come in various denominations. You can purchase an Amazon Gift Card from Amazon’s website or from third-party sellers.

If you want to give someone an Amazon gift card, you can choose between a physical or digital card.

There are three types of Amazon gift cards:

Physical gift cards
E/Digital Gift Cards
Anytime gift cards
Physical gift cards
You can purchase these traditional gift cards from Amazon or from third-party sellers. Physical gift cards come in a cardboard envelope with a unique 14-digit code printed on the back. Electronic digital gift cards
E-Digital Gift Cards are the electronic version of Amazon’s physical gift cards. These cards are delivered to the recipient via email. The email contains a link to the eGift Card and instructions on how to redeem and use the card.

You can personalize e-gift cards with a message to the recipient. In addition, you can choose the delivery date when you want the recipient to receive the gift Do Amazon Gift Cards Expire if Not Redeemed.
